19 November Albert Ng Nguyen Tags 59 Marion St, Albert Ng, Albert Ng or Nguyen, Albie, canada, Don’t snitch, Goldensnitches, goof, ont, rat, Snitch, Snitching, Stop Snitching, toronto Read More